Emerson, NJ: A Thriving Hub for Nursing Professionals Amidst Growing Healthcare Demand and Community Charm

Emerson cityscape

Living in Emerson, New Jersey, I find our small but vibrant town brimming with community spirit and charm. Nestled in Bergen County, Emerson has that quintessential suburban feel, with tree-lined streets, friendly neighbors, and a quaint downtown area dotted with local cafés and shops. The nursing job market here reflects the community's commitment to health and wellness, driven by a close-knit healthcare environment and several nearby major hospitals, including Hackensack University Medical Center and Valley Hospital. As of 2023, hourly salaries for nurses in Emerson generally range from $33 to $45 depending on their specialties and experience levels, contrasting with the state average of about $41.30 and the national average of $40.25 per hour according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ics. This not only highlights our competitive pay but also indicates the high demand for skilled nursing professionals that can be found right here in our town. With the scenic backdrop of the surrounding parks and the activities they offer—from our annual Summer Festival to enjoying the quiet beauty of the Oradell Reservoir—Emerson epitomizes a work-life balance that many healthcare professionals seek.

Analyzing the job market, Emerson is experiencing robust growth in the healthcare sector as the population ages and healthcare services become increasingly vital. In the next five years, NurseRecruiter estimates that Emerson will need around 150 new nurses to meet the rising demand, corresponding to approximately a 15% increase in the nursing workforce based on current trends. To put things into perspective, there are approximately 1,000 nurses currently practicing in our city. Moreover, the demand for travel nursing positions and per diem roles is steadily climbing, especially during flu season and various health awareness months, indicating a potential seasonal trend with opportunities peaking in late fall and early spring. While nearby towns like Park Ridge and Westwood also offer nursing positions, they often feature lower salary averages, with their nurses earning around $30 to $38 per hour. In contrast, larger cities such as Jersey City and Newark provide a plethora of opportunities, but commuters often find a more appealing lifestyle and less crowded setting in Emerson, prompting a strong appeal to local nurses who might otherwise seek employment in the more bustling environments.

In terms of healthcare infrastructure, Emerson is bolstered by numerous clinics, outpatient facilities, and a strong network of primary care providers. Continuing investments in our local healthcare infrastructure, along with initiatives aimed at enhancing public health education and vaccinations, support the demand for specialized nursing roles. With a population hovering around 7,500, Emerson’s growth rate reflects a steady increase; recently experiencing a 1.5% growth, it's safe to project this trend to maintain our communities’ lively spirit and healthcare needs.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ing in Emerson

Do I need to be licensed in New Jersey to work in Emerson?
Good news! New Jersey is a member of the eNLC (Enhanced Nurse Licensure Compact). You can practice here with a compact license from any member state.
